MAT 152 - Basic Calculus with Applications II
Intended for majors that emphasize techniques and applications. The second course in a two-course sequence. Topics to include further techniques and applications of integration, multivariable calculus, differential equations, probability, sequences and series, and trigonometric functions.
3.000 Credit hours
3.000 Lecture hours

Levels: Undergraduate
Schedule Types: Lecture

Mathematics & Statistics Department

Course Attributes:
UnvStdy Critical Reasoning, UnvStdy Math & Statistics
